This article describes requirements and challenges of cross-platform multi-touch software engineering, and presents the open source framework Multi-Touch for Java (MT4j) as a solution. MT4j is designed for rapid development of graphically rich applications on a variety of contemporary hardware, from common PCs and notebooks to large-scale ambient displays, as well as different operating systems. The framework has a special focus on making multi-touch software development easier and more efficient. Architecture and abstractions used by MT4j are described, and implementations of several common use cases are presented
Multi-touch refers to a touch system's ability to simultaneously detect and resolve a minimum of 3+ ...
Over the past few years, multi-touch user interfaces emerged from research prototypes into mass mark...
Simple Multi-Touch: A framework for teaching multi-touch computing 1. import vialab.simpleMultiTouch...
Multi-touch has been one of the hot topics within the areas of human computer interaction and comput...
Developing applications for touch devices is hard. Developing touch based applications for multi-use...
Multi-touch-Hardware bietet neue, teils beeindruckende Möglichkeiten zur Interaktion mit Computern. ...
Multi-touch driven user interfaces are becoming increasingly prevalent because of their intuitivenes...
Includes bibliographical references (leaf 36)Since Apple has introduced iPhone and iPod touch, the c...
The Java Programming Language revolutionized the world of software development in the last decades. ...
Software developers of today are under increasing pressure to support multiple platforms, in particu...
It is challenging to develop a cross-platform application, that is, an application that runs on mult...
A platform independent multi-touch software framework. This software relies on an externally provide...
The content of this thesis is a process of finding a solution for improvement of multi-touch multi-u...
A project about enhancing the graphics capabilities of a commercial multi-touch product as well as ...
The number and types of applications developed for multi-touch tabletops are dramatically increased ...
Multi-touch refers to a touch system's ability to simultaneously detect and resolve a minimum of 3+ ...
Over the past few years, multi-touch user interfaces emerged from research prototypes into mass mark...
Simple Multi-Touch: A framework for teaching multi-touch computing 1. import vialab.simpleMultiTouch...
Multi-touch has been one of the hot topics within the areas of human computer interaction and comput...
Developing applications for touch devices is hard. Developing touch based applications for multi-use...
Multi-touch-Hardware bietet neue, teils beeindruckende Möglichkeiten zur Interaktion mit Computern. ...
Multi-touch driven user interfaces are becoming increasingly prevalent because of their intuitivenes...
Includes bibliographical references (leaf 36)Since Apple has introduced iPhone and iPod touch, the c...
The Java Programming Language revolutionized the world of software development in the last decades. ...
Software developers of today are under increasing pressure to support multiple platforms, in particu...
It is challenging to develop a cross-platform application, that is, an application that runs on mult...
A platform independent multi-touch software framework. This software relies on an externally provide...
The content of this thesis is a process of finding a solution for improvement of multi-touch multi-u...
A project about enhancing the graphics capabilities of a commercial multi-touch product as well as ...
The number and types of applications developed for multi-touch tabletops are dramatically increased ...
Multi-touch refers to a touch system's ability to simultaneously detect and resolve a minimum of 3+ ...
Over the past few years, multi-touch user interfaces emerged from research prototypes into mass mark...
Simple Multi-Touch: A framework for teaching multi-touch computing 1. import vialab.simpleMultiTouch...